When the tasks were migrated from belonging directly to a bucket to only belonging to a view, I forgot to add the view in that migration, resulting in task buckets where the view was 0. These entries were not deleted when a task was moved between buckets, but the new task bucket relation nevertheless inserted. This resulted in tasks showing up multiple times on the kanban board.
This change adds a new migration which adds the correct project view id (as derived from the bucket) and fixes the old migration as well.
